Nine players dropped from the Malkia Strikers squad for the World Championship

Nine players have been dropped from the National Volleyball women’s team, Malkia Strikers, ahead of the FIVB World Championship set for August 22 to September 7 in Thailand...
✨ Key Highlights
Malkia Strikers, the National Volleyball women’s team, has reduced its squad from 29 to 20 players ahead of the FIVB World Championship. Nine players were dropped from the team currently training in Kenya, with the final 14-player squad to be announced early next month.
- Nine players, including Valerie Chepkoech and Sharon Sandui (injured), were dropped from the provisional squad.
- The team will travel to Vietnam between 15th and 20th August for friendly matches before the World Championship.
- Kenya is placed in Pool G for the FIVB World Championship, alongside Germany, Poland, and Vietnam.
